Australian Authorities Demand Roblox Enhance Child Safety Measures

Australian regulators are increasing their scrutiny of child safety measures on online platforms, specifically targeting Roblox due to rising concerns about explicit and exploitative content accessible to minors. The government, alongside the Australian eSafety Commission, is pressing for immediate action from Roblox, as existing social media bans for children under 16 do not extend to gaming environments. Lawmakers emphasize the need for more transparent safety practices from global gaming companies, particularly those that rely heavily on user-generated content.

The call for action follows alarming media reports documenting instances where young users have encountered disturbing material on Roblox, including sexual content and self-harm discussions. Reports have emerged of predators using the platform to target children, prompting Communications Minister Anika Wells and eSafety Commissioner Julie Inman Grant to formally request an explanation from Roblox regarding its strategies to mitigate these dangers.

Roblox’s Responses to Regulatory Pressures

Roblox has previously committed to adhering to Australia’s Online Safety Act, implementing several safety measures aimed at protecting younger users. These measures include mandatory private accounts for users under 16, restrictions on voice chat for certain age groups, and facial age checks to access chat features. According to Roblox, these changes have been deployed globally. Yet, regulators have expressed dissatisfaction with the platform’s ability to consistently enforce these safeguards against predatory behavior and inappropriate content generated by users.

The Australian eSafety Commission has announced its intention to evaluate how effectively Roblox meets its nine safety commitments. Non-compliance could lead to fines of up to AU$49.5 million. The review process will involve active monitoring and practical testing to assess the implementation and real-world impact of the safety features that Roblox has outlined.

Ongoing Concerns and Potential Consequences

“We remain highly concerned by ongoing reports regarding the exploitation of children on the Roblox service and exposure to harmful material,” commented the eSafety Commissioner. The increasing scrutiny reflects a growing expectation for Roblox to fulfill its responsibilities, especially in light of disturbing reports of children encountering graphic user-generated content on the platform, including sexually explicit and suicidal material.

Wells has voiced her alarm over these reports, underscoring the urgent need for substantial and verifiable changes within digital environments frequented by minors. The ongoing regulatory focus on Roblox illustrates the broader challenges in moderating user-driven content on major social platforms. As global standards for child safety vary, enforcement heavily relies on effective technological tools and comprehensive reporting systems.

Parents and guardians of young gamers are urged to remain vigilant, fostering open dialogue about online activities and utilizing parental controls available on Roblox and similar services. Regulatory actions across various countries indicate a concerted effort to hold digital platforms accountable for child safety, compelling companies to maintain rigorous monitoring standards and transparent communication with authorities and their user communities.
